Adobe Flash Player does not work with Safari. What can I do?
Hi,
I have a MacBook Pro, Retina, 15 inch, late 2013, 2 GHz Intel Core i7, using OS X 10.9.4. I have installed Adobe Flash Player. In my System Preference, in the advanced settings, it is set to install updates also tells me that I have the NPAPI Plug-in (version 14.0.0.145) installed but not the PPAPI Plug-in. Is this the reason why it does not work with Safari (keeps telling me to download the app, which I did but still does not work)? Is there any way I could fix the problem? Please, help.
Thanks.If you can't install or update Flash, follow these instructions.
If you have installed the latest version of Flash, please take each of the following steps that you haven't already tried. After each step, relaunch Safari and test. For a "missing plug-in" error, start with Step 8. Back up all data before making any changes.
Step 1
You might have to log out or restart the computer before a Flash update takes effect.
Step 2
From the Safari menu bar, select
Safari ▹ Preferences... ▹ Privacy ▹ Remove All Website Data...
and confirm. Close the window. Then select
▹ System Preferences… ▹ Flash Player ▹ Advanced
and click Delete All. Close the preference pane.
Step 3
If you're only having trouble with YouTube videos, log in to YouTube and load this page. You may see a link with the text "Leave the HTML5 Trial." If so, click that link.
Step 4
a. If you get a warning of a "blocked" or "outdated" plug-in, then select the Security tab in the Safari preferences window. In the list of plugins on the left, there should be one—and only one—entry for "Adobe Flash Player," showing the same version number that you installed. Select that entry. On the right there will be a list of websites for which you have specifically allowed Flash, if any. It's normal for the list to be empty. Below that is a menu labeled
When visiting other websites
From that menu, select either Allow or Ask.
b. If you still get the alerts, then go back to the Flash Player preference pane and select the Advanced tab. Click Check Now. Quit and relaunch the browser.
c. If the alerts still persist, triple-click anywhere in the line below on this page to select it:
/System/Library/CoreServices/CoreTypes.bundle/Contents/Resources
Right-click or control-click the highlighted text and select
Services ▹ Open
from the contextual menu.* A folder should open. Inside it, there should be a file named "XProtect.meta.plist". If that file is missing and you know why it's missing, restore it from a backup or copy it from another Mac running the same version of OS X. Otherwise, reinstall OS X.
*If you don't see the contextual menu item, copy the selected text to the Clipboard by pressing the key combination command-C. In the Finder, select
Go ▹ Go to Folder...
from the menu bar and paste into the box that opens by pressing command-V. You won't see what you pasted because a line break is included. Press return.
Step 5
In the Safari preferences window, select the Advanced tab and uncheck the box marked
Stop plug-ins to save power
Step 6
Open this folder as in Step 4:
/Library/Internet Plug-Ins
Delete the following item, or anything with a similar name, if present:
Flash Player (failing).plugin
You may be prompted for your login password.
Step 7
Re-download and reinstall Flash. Download it from the domain "get.adobe.com". Don't click a link from any other website, including this one, because you can't trust links. They may be an attempt to trick you into installing malware masquerading as Flash. Type the address into the browser window. Never download a Flash update from anywhere else.
Step 8
If you get a "missing plug-in" error, select
Safari ▹ Preferences... ▹ Security
from the Safari menu bar and check the box marked
Allow (or Enable) plug-ins
Then click the button marked
Manage Website Settings...
if present and make sure that the website is not blocked for Flash.
Step 9
Select
Safari ▹ Preferences... ▹ Extensions
from the Safari menu bar. If any extensions are installed, disable them. -

Lightroom : does it work with 2 intern HD's in mirror
Lightroom : does it work with 2 intern data HD's in mirror with the name for exemple H:\ Because Windows see dis 2 intern HD's as 1 volume(1 piece)
and Lightroom is standard installed on C:\ Programfiles\Adobe\Adobe Photoshop Lightroom ..
and the libary is standard placet in on C:\ Documents and Settings\Jan\My documents\ my pictures(mijn afbeeldingen)\Lightroom\ Lightroom ... Catalog.lrcat
\ Backups LTR...
\Lightroom .. Catalog Previews.lrdata
Note: "Jan" is not my real first nameI assume you mean if you can use an internal hard disk in mirrored RAID setup?
Yes, you can, but LR will see only one of the RAID disks. Otherwise you would have redundant images in your catalog. If one disk fails, you would update the folder location to the other RAID disk.
Provided the RAID controller still works....
I had this desaster once when the RAID controller died together with one disk. It was hell of an effort to get the remaining disk readable, because it insists on its RAID controller.
So do not mistake this setup as your only backup solution.

Flash player does not work with Ie or Firefox with win 8.1?
Flash player does not work with Ie or Firefox with win 8.1 64, If i try and play a video I get the message to install Flashplayer.
If I try and install it it says it is already installed. Your onsite installer says it is not applicable to my machine.
I have followed all the normal steps re enabling addons and active filters etc.
all to no avail Pc is Dell 6 months old, Flashplayer has never worked on this machine. Last MS update mid Dec 2014.
Version of flashplayer is 15....03.......Flash Player is a built-in component of Internet Explorer. There's nothing separate to download or install.
Firefox requires a different version of Flash Player (the NPAPI plug-in), which will be served to you if you go here: http://get.adobe.com/flashplayer using Firefox; however, there are some unique stability issues related to Firefox on Win8.1, and you're probably better off using Google Chrome if you want a more optimal experience with Flash Player.
For problems where IE isn't being detected by sites that require Flash:
First, confirm that ActiveX Filtering is configured to allow Flash content:
https://forums.adobe.com/thread/867968
Internet Explorer 11 introduces a number of changes both to how the browser identifies itself to remote web servers, and to how it processes JavaScript intended to target behaviors specific to Internet Explorer. Unfortunately, this means that content on some sites will be broken until the content provider changes their site to conform to the new development approach required by modern versions of IE.
You can try to work around these issues by using Compatibility View:
http://windows.microsoft.com/en-us/internet-explorer/use-compatibility-view#ie=ie-11 -

I am thinking of returning the TC if I don't make it work now, but how do I delete all the data that's on it?I can deal with the last question first and easily.
I am thinking of returning the TC if I don't make it work now, but how do I delete all the data that's on it?
Open the airport utility .. go to the disk tab and select erase.
When you select erase you will get mulitiple options.
Quick removes the file table but does not delete the files,, it takes 2min or less.
A Zero out data is the secure way,, by writing 0 ie low level drive format.
It can take several hours..
7 pass will take a week.. not recommended..
35 pass erase is ridiculous.. it would take a month.. put an ax through the TC. It is quick and better.
Now, as I have my second WiFi network, and the APExspress is reconfigured, it's like the TC thinks, I am the base boss here, I am not taking orders from APE one more time, and it simply does not work, not only that, it fluctuates all the time.
The fact that it did work and has now failed might point to faulty unit.
The only way to tell is reset it properly to factory and start over.
Universal Factory Reset.. any model TC or AE.
Unplug your TC/AE from power or turn off at the power point.
Hold in reset. and power the TC/AE back on.. all without releasing reset and keep holding in for about 10sec. (this is often difficult without a 2nd person or a 3rd arm).
Release it when the status light flashes rapidly. If it doesn’t flash rapidly you have missed it and try again.
Note..
Be Gentle! Feel the switch click on. It has a positive feel.. add no more pressure after that.
TC/AE will reboot after a couple of minutes with default factory settings and will wipe out previous configurations of the router.
No files are deleted on the hard disk in a TC.. No reset of the TC deletes files.. to do that you use erase from the airport utility.
Generally having multiple wireless AP should not cause problems.. but it is better to set channels manually.. so it doesn't go beserk rotating channels.
Remember to keep all names short, no spaces and pure alphanumeric.
Sadly though the Apple routers have no logging now and no SNMP and almost nothing to help diagnose a problem, so if it continues .. take it back to apple.. they have given you no other method of fixing it. -
